Why Choosing the Right Formation Service Matters in the Netherlands in 2026

Setting up a limited company in the Netherlands, known as a BV (besloten vennootschap), is a popular choice for foreign entrepreneurs. In 2026, the Dutch market remains a gateway to Europe for e-commerce sellers, startups, and multinationals. However, the formation process involves legal steps like a notarial deed, registration with the Chamber of Commerce (KvK), and tax registration with the Dutch tax authorities.

A reliable company formation service handles all these steps for you. If you choose the wrong provider, you might face delays, hidden costs, or gaps in post-formation support. Post-Formation Services: What You Actually Need Beyond the BV Setup

Forming the BV is only the first step. After that, you need a Dutch business bank account, VAT registration (BTW), and possibly an EORI number for customs. Many companies also require payroll and accounting support.

Cost Comparison: Formation Fees and Hidden Charges in 2026

The price of forming a Dutch BV varies between 200 euros and over 1,500 euros, depending on the provider and included services. Some companies advertise a low formation fee but add extra costs for the notarial deed, power of attorney, or Chamber of Commerce registration. What is the minimum share capital for a Dutch BV in 2026?

You can form a BV with share capital from 1 euro. There is no minimum requirement anymore, making it accessible for startups and small businesses.
